Build My Rank Is Awesome Because
It is a large index of high PR sites that you post short articles to with a link back to your site. Some say PR doesn't matter, but it does when you are attaining links. Of course, many of these high PR sites will drop during the next update, but we will have still gotten their link juice at their peak, and our PR might go up because of it.
It is so easy to use. I am used to using PostRunner, which was previously the easiest tool to use out there. Build My Rank is much, much faster. I copy, paste and click to add another. You won't get in and out of an article directory site much faster.
I like the 150 word set up. Some say one link per article passes more link juice than two. I tend to agree with that logic. The article is more focused, and my writers churn out more of them.
It has built my rank. It works. It works well. I am sitting in the prime spot in Google for a number of keywords that I have used mostly Build My Rank for, and I have only been using it for a month. It is a powerful tool.

Build My Rank Is A Scam Because...
First, the definition of scam, according to Meriam Webster:
"a fraudulent or deceptive act or operation"
Thus, I must in all honesty say that Build My Rank is a scam. They lie consistently about their index rates. My index rates are around 80%, according to Google. That is, when I use their own button to check to see if my posts are indexed, eight out of ten are not. Yet, they have marked them off as indexed and claim that my index rate is around 97%.
Here's the story. I am new to internet marketing. I am still in my first year. Am I making money? Yes. Are there others that are newer? Yes. Do I know much? Not really. But I do know that a page that is not indexed carries no weight with Google. That is why they say they have such a high indexing rate, because everyone knows that if a post is not indexed, it does not help.
So, about these index rates... I had noticed that I had a lot of posts marked as not indexed for a long time. Then, one day when I logged into my dashboard, I saw that they had put up the months stats for the indexing rates. My indexing rates were marked as higher than the site's average. So, I started checking. The one that caught the most attention was the first post I had submitted. Now, I have submitted over 200, so I don't track all of my posts carefully, but I noticed that my first post had been marked as not indexed a few days earlier. When I went back and checked it again, it was marked as indexed even though it still wasn't indexed.
I checked a few more, and lo, there were a bunch of posts marked as indexed even though they weren't indexed. These coincided with the amount of posts that were marked as not indexed a few days earlier. It was like someone went through and marked all of my not indexed posts as being indexed so that they could say my indexing rate was higher. If that isn't a scam, what is?

UPDATE: I take it all back!
I do, I take it all back. I have had a correspondence with the admin at Build My Rank. I will say that he was a little short and had a slightly unprofessional tone, but I did accuse him of lying, so....
Anyway, he sent me the links to the posts that had been marked as indexed even though their tool was telling me that they weren't indexed. Indeed, they are indexed. Their tool, which anonymously Googles a sentence in quotes from the article, doesn't pick them all up. I was actually pretty impressed. I checked in yahoo and Bing as well and wasn't able to find them. Any tips on how to find a post without the URL if Googling a segment in quotes doesn't work?
This does show a downside to Build My Rank, though. If you can't find your posts, you can't bookmark them. From my experience, bookmarking is the most time efficient way to ensure that the posts stay indexed. So, I can only bookmark the ones that are already strong enough to be picked up from their little tool. I know that Build My Rank tweets them or something, but I want to do more.

NEW UPDATE: 01-16-11
I've been following the indexing rate pretty closely and there is some pretty scammy stuff going on. They are misleading you about their index rates and that is a fact.
They mark the posts as indexed as soon as they possibly can, often when the post is still on the homepage of the site. Then, when it gets moved to the back pages, the individual post that your link is on is often not indexed at all.
From what I have recorded, there is about an 90% index rate.
Again, this isn't bad, and my ranks have been improved from this service, but the idea of a publish and forget service is not the reality. You need to bookmark the individual URLs as soon as possible or the post may never be indexed. Still, I recommend this service and am paying for it myself.
Their index checking tool is glitchy. You click it once and it often doesn't work. Click it a few times. Sometimes the URL isn't indexed, but some of the text may be in the feeds that they submit it to. You can find the URL to bookmark it this way.
